Facebook information security outrage
In the 2016 US official political decision, Cambridge Analytica, a British counseling firm, utilized individual information gathered across Facebook stages for political notice without express permission. Facebook holds information from around 33% of the worldwide populace since it has numerous dynamic clients. Individual data from more than 87 million individuals were utilized to immensely impact the official political decision results (Patterson, 2020). The firm was the necessary specialist for Donald Trump's mission, and his triumph in the decisions is connected to the information security embarrassment. Cambridge Analytica had simple admittance to individual information because of organizations' comprehensive agreements and indulgent laws against information reaping. Engineers from the firm planned an application with a character test that examiners used to gather essential data that empowered Cambridge Analytica to fabricate psychographic profiles.
Online media clients were needed to connect the application to their Facebook records to participate in the character test. The linkage between the application and the Facebook account gave the firm limitless admittance to the client's very own data, including the person's Facebook companions. The organization was uncovered in 2018 by Wylie, an information researcher who had left the firm before the embarrassment. He discovered that Cambridge Analytica had collected a great deal of information, and Facebook didn't forestall information gathering (Patterson, 2 ...
